Soon you’ll be able to stuff a Pikachu at Build-A-Bear stores

The Pokemon Company has announced that its mascot Pikachu will be added to the licensed collection of toys available at Build-A-bear Workshop.

The character will be launched in early 2016 across Europe, North America and Australia. Those who choose to stuff their own Pikachu either in-store or online will also get a Build-A-Bear branded Pokemon trading card.

A Poke Ball hoodie and Charizard costume will be among the optional custom adornments along with a Pokemon sound chip.

Pokemon and Build-A-Bear Workshop both create memorable experiences for fans of all ages,” The Pokemon Company International’s director of licensing Monika Salazar said. We are delighted to partner with a brand like Build-A-Bear Workshop that represents fun and friendship.”

Pokemon joins a long list of licensed Build-A-Bear partners that currently includes Star Wars, the Minions, The Avengers, My Little Pony, Peppa Pig and Frozen.
